Bob... I can't really explain it. I know that the 2004 and earlier stangs used an offset close to 24mm. And the 2005+ uses close to 45mm, so when I was looking to buy I had to make sure the offset was closer to 45 and not 24. On ebay some of the rims say they will fit 2005 but the offset says 24mm. Don't buy those they will not fit right.

The ones with a 24mm offset will fit but they tend to stick out further, you just have to stick with smaller size tires, like 255's.
